The Umayyad Mosque, an essential milestone in early Islamic architecture, was built between 705-715 by the Umayyad Caliph Al-Walid ibn Abd al-Malik. Renowned in art and architectural history, the mosque is notable for its history, plan system, decorations, and architectural details. After Yavuz Sultan Selim's conquest of Damascus, the mosque came under Ottoman control. During the Ottoman period, the mosque underwent several interventions but suffered significant damage in a fire on October 15, 1893, during Sultan Abdulhamid II’s reign. The fire nearly destroyed the mosque, including the structure traditionally believed to be the Tomb of Prophet John, due to strong winds. Several surrounding buildings, too, were destroyed. Once the news reached Istanbul, restoration efforts were quickly initiated. Both locals and people from Istanbul contributed to the repair work. Edmonde Beşare’s reinforced concrete-based preliminary projects for the repairs were significant. Sultan Abdulhamid II tasked Osman Hamdi Bey with reporting on the mosque’s repairs. Osman Hamdi Bey recommended the "Tarz-ı Kadim" (old style) method for the restoration, favoring traditional Ottoman techniques over the suggested reinforced concrete. This approach reflected the classical Ottoman architectural period. The restoration highlighted the National Architectural Style, which would later become the state’s official style in 1908, being applied even before that. Changes to the mosque during the repairs, such as the addition of a muqarnas arch in the mihrab and a marble pulpit replacing the wooden one, demonstrate the National Architectural Style's influence. This restoration marks a key moment in the development of modern restoration awareness in the late Ottoman Empire.
